[0016] Accompanying drawing is a kind of specific embodiment of the present invention. as attached Figure 1-3 As shown, the closed bus bridge grounding ring of the substation is characterized in that it includes a bus connection device at the bottom, a connection shaft device above the bus connection device, and a grounding ring 1 fixed above the connection shaft device. The bus connection device consists of a connection plate 7 and The connecting plate 7 and the pressing plate 5 are connected by bolts 4 at both ends. The connecting plate 7 and the pressing plate 5 have the same specifications, both of which are 130mm long, 30mm wide and 4mm thick.
